llama

5 senses · Free VividLex dictionary · Thesaurus

  1. 1. n. A South American ruminant (Auchenia llama), allied to the camels, but much smaller and without a hump. It is supposed to be a domesticated variety of the guanaco. It was formerly much used as a beast of burden in the Andes. Source: opted
  2. 2. n. wild or domesticated South American cud-chewing animal related to camels but smaller and lacking a hump Source: wordnet
